Real-life experience of eXtreme Programming from XP programmers.
eXtreme Programming (XP) is a hot new development methodology for building software systems quickly without sacrificing quality. Authors Lippert, Wolf and Rook have three years' experience of working on professional XP projects. The projects range from application via prototype to framework development and cover project sizes from one person month to more than 400 person months. Until now XP has been described in outline by those promoting its advantages, this book provides objective examples of how it can be used in practice.
* An objective assessment of XP, grounded in real world experience, and not written by those championing this method
* Invaluable combination of theory and practice
* Covers advanced topics such as project organization, team roles and integrating legacy systems

Martin Lippert, Stefan Roock and Henning Wolf, all at University of Hamburg, Hamburg, Germany.
Lippert, Roock and Wolfe are project coaches for extreme programming and software architectures in the professional architecting and consulting work they undertake for APCON Workplace Solutions, a company associated with the University at which they also hold research positions. Lippert is on the program committee of Extreme Programming Conference in 2002.
The introduction of XP has brought a breath of fresh air to programming, bringing a simple, disciplined and clean approach to software development and a renewed emphasis on customer involvement and teamwork. It is a re-examination of software development practices. It claims to offer a lightweight, streamlined approach, which tackles problems efficiently and reduces the cost of software. And being a lightweight process it is simple and enjoyable to use. But how well does this claim stand up in practice?
Martin Lippert, Steffan Roock and Henning Wolf demonstrate how XP has worked in real projects. The authors explain each technique and demonstrate how eXreme Programming can be most successfully put to real use.
eXtreme Programming In Action shows you
* How XP practices measure up on concrete development projects.
* What effect project organisation, team roles and integrating legacy systems may have
* What works, what doesn't, and what to beware of.
Written with the benefit of three years of highly technical and practical experience on a variety of XP projects, eXtreme Programming in Action is an objective and results-based assessment of XP techniques.
